Carroll dominated once more after giving up first goal, won 3-1 over Vipers


Luke Vanantwerp and Brody Rosswurm got the starts for their respective clubs for the second match of the night. Vanantwerp made 18 total saves, whereas Rosswurm made 51. 

First Period

Vipers struck first at 6:56. Nick Vanryn got the goal and Jackson Bertels with the assist. The only other play of the period came at the very end when Grant Knudson went off for a hook with 28.3 seconds left. Carroll finished with 16 shots and the Vipers finished with 7.

Second Period

Michael Scully laid a huge hit on a Charger and got a 5 and a game for boarding. During that five-minute penalty, Carroll scored twice. The first one was a low glove-side goal at 9:47, about a minute into the penalty. Dylan Braun got the goal, and Sam Krauhs had the helper. The second goal was shot on the top of the circle, top shelf, glove side by Davis Cline. Vipers’ Mason Johnson went off for a cross-check at 3:50. He crosschecked Adlee Scheerer- nearside post (in the trapezoid by the red line if there was a trapezoid). The Vipers were penalized in quick succession when Grant Knudson went off for a cross-check. Vipers are going back on the man’s disadvantage once more, this time with 41.2 seconds left as Jackson Bertels was called for kneeing. At the end of the second, Carroll had 42 shots, and the Vipers had 11.

Third Period

Fort Wayne Vipers killed off the 5-on-3. Carroll went on a penalty of their own as Davis Cline was called for elbowing at 12:27. Vipers were unsuccessful on the power play attempt. Carroll scored on the delayed call (elbowing on 16) at 9:30. Dylan Braun got his second of the night, top shelf off in front. Gnau got the assist. Vipers headed to the box at 8:47, Jackson Bertels with the trip. Carroll’s Braun going off at 6:22 for unsportsmanlike. The Vipers tried to pull their goaltender to get the offense going but could not find the back of the net.
